How Common Is The Last Name Bakutis? popularity and diffusion

The last name Bakutis is the 543,414th most numerous last name world-wide It is held by approximately 1 in 12,351,773 people. The last name Bakutis is mostly found in Europe, where 65 percent of Bakutis are found; 54 percent are found in Northern Europe and 53 percent are found in Baltic Europe.

The surname is most common in Lithuania, where it is borne by 310 people, or 1 in 9,789. In Lithuania Bakutis is most numerous in: Kaunas County, where 54 percent reside, Utena County, where 15 percent reside and Panevėžys County, where 13 percent reside. Besides Lithuania it occurs in 13 countries. It also occurs in The United States, where 34 percent reside and Russia, where 9 percent reside.
